About Copper

Meet Copper, a curious and clever approximately 3-month-old medium-haired tabby kitten with an intriguing spotted coat. She’s not one to rush into things, preferring to assess her surroundings before diving in. New people? She’ll take a moment to figure them out. New toys? A thorough investigation is in order. But when it comes to play, don't mistake her calm demeanor; Copper can pounce and play with the best of them. She thrives on companionship, especially with her sister Cobalt, though she would also enjoy the company of her other siblings, Platinum or Gold. Copper loves climbing, batting around her ball-track toy, and, surprisingly, watching Bird TV—she might just believe those birds are inside the screen! Though she’s affectionate and gentle, Copper needs a family that can give her the time and space to bloom into her full personality. She’s house trained, up to date on vaccinations, and ready to bring joy to your home. Just ensure she has access to her favorite shows!
